WebJan 4, 2024 · The most natural explanation for a day being measured from evening to morning in Genesis 1 is that the beginning of time was marked by darkness. Genesis 1:2 notes, “The earth was without form and void, and darkness was over the face of the deep.”. Then, in Genesis 1:3-5, “God said, ‘Let there be light,’ and there was light.

WebMar 30, 2024 · This evening, find a wonderous celestial scene in the western sky. The best views begin about 45 minutes after sunset. The crescent moon, 16% illuminated, is nearly 35° up in the western sky and 5.6° to the upper left of Venus. Look carefully for Elnath, the Bull’s northern horn, 3.2° above the crescent.
